Events Officer Jobs in Qatar 2023 Full Job Descripation

Job Purpose:

To raise the visibility of the school by planning, organising and delivering a wide range of activities and events for SISQ that support internal and external strategic goals, leading both the retention of students and SISQ continued growth, while collaborating with a wide range of stakeholders.
The primary focus of the role is to co-plan, coordinate and manage a calendar of external and internal events on and off
campus, organising and running these events, as well as supporting Academic and Non-Academic in delivering the school activities.
Additionally support the Marketing and Communications Officer in Marketing related activities.

Core Responsibilities:
• Active member of the Events and Activities Committee, leading the coordination of all activities
• Design an annual activities and events plan that supports SISQ strategic objectives including the correspondent budget (activities include Enrichment Activities, Community Activities and Trips)
• Pro-actively encourage contributions from staff for the development of the activities and events calendar
• Source  service providers for activities and events (including but not limited to: source potential service providers, negotiate, draft contracts, build up the relationship)
• Manage the organisation of the activities and events in what budget and operations are concerned, liaising with School Life Officer to prepare Club Sys and with the Facilities Officer to allocate the necessary locations
• Analyse the profitability of the activities and events and conduct satisfaction surveys
• Ensure that SISQ activities and events are timely, well promoted through effective marketing and communications across multiple channels reaching the target audience
• Liaise with key members of staff to identify image opportunities (photo/video); regularly document day-to-day activities and events at the school for marketing purposes
• Work collaboratively with the Marketing and Events Officer, to support, promote and execute school activities and events, including but not limited to photo and video documentation
• Create SISQ activities and events materials/content for internal and external use
• Ensure SISQ activities and events advertisement appears in the appropriate channels in order to reach the target audience and that entries are accurate and kept up to date
• Regularly review other schools’ activities and events as well as market changes
• Ensure that all material/content created for the activities follow the brand guidelines
• Liaise with MoEHE Coordinator and the Health and Safety area to ensure all activities and events comply with MoEHE, MoPH and other authorities’ requirements
• Collaborate with the Marketing and Communications Officer in the execution of the digital strategy through website, social media, and online campaigns, ensuring a strong brand message and positioning through a clear communication mix
• Support the Marketing and Communications Officer with the marketing activities
• Performs a wide range of administrative tasks/functions

Qualifications, Experience and Attributes:

● Bachelor degree ideally within marketing, economics, management (project management certification seen as an advantage)
● Minimum 3 years’ work experience in PR and/or events organisation. It is desirable that you have a background in education.
● Proven track record of leading and executing successful activities and events
● Creative, service mindset, organisational and planning skills
● Proficient in Adobe Photoshop, iMovie, Canva Pro
● Photography course/experience
● Excellent communication skills with fluency in English. French and Arabic are seen as an advantage.
● Hands-on approach, sales-minded, energetic, positive, problem-solving attitude
● A team player with strong interpersonal and communications skills
● Organised and able to keep on top of many details, prioritising effectively
● It is a mandatory requirement that all SISQ staff adhere to the SISQ Student Safeguarding, Staff Code of Conduct, Child Protection Policy.
